Unemployment, youth total (% of total labor force ages 15-24) in Saudi Arabia
Saudi Arabia: Unemployment, youth total (% of total labor force ages 15-24) was 10.0% in 2025. ▼ Falling
Unemployment, youth total (% of total labor force ages 15-24) in Saudi Arabia, 1991–2025
Source: ILO Modelled Estimates database (ILOEST), International Labour Organization (ILO).
Analysis
The most recent figure for unemployment, youth total (% of total labor force ages 15-24) in Saudi Arabia is 10.0%, measured in 2025. That is the lowest value across all 35 years on record.
That represents a change of down 13.0% on the previous year and down 64.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, unemployment, youth total (% of total labor force ages 15-24) in Saudi Arabia peaked at 33.0% in 1991 and was at its lowest, 10.0%, in 2025.
Saudi Arabia ranks 117th of 187 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 35 years of available data.

Saudi Arabia compared with similar countries
- Saudi Arabia's 10.0% is below the median for high income countries, which is 13.8%, 73% of the median. (62 countries reporting)
- Saudi Arabia's 10.0% is below the median for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an, which is 21.9%, 46% of the median. (23 countries reporting)

About this data
Youth unemployment refers to the share of the labor force ages 15-24 without work but available for and seeking employment.
